Choose The Correct Option:
1. Who is the author of “De La Division du Travail Social”?
(a) Emile Durkheim.
(b) Karl Marx.
(c) Max Weber.
(d) M. N. Srinivas.
Ans: (a) Emile Durkheim.
2. Who wrote the famous book “Division of Labour in Society”?
(a) Herbert Spencer.
(b) Max Weber.
(c) Kingsley Davis.
(d) Emile Durkheim.
Ans: (d) Emile Durkheim.
3. How many types of co-operation are there?
(a) Four.
(b) Six.
(c) Two.
(d) Three.
Ans: (c) Two.
4. “The history of all hitherto existing society is the history of class struggle.” Who said this?
(a) P. V. Young.
(b) Karl Marx.
(c) Mary Stevenson.
(d) C. A. Moser.
Ans: (b) Karl Marx.

13. In which year was “Division of Labour in Society” published?
(a) 1792.
(b) 1887.
(c) 1878.
(d) 1893.
Ans: (d) 1893.
14. During which century did the principle of free economy play a key role in economic development through competition?
(a) 19th century.
(b) 20th century.
(c) 14th century.
(d) 15th century.
Ans: (a) 19th century.
15. The position a person occupies in a group or society is called—
(a) Value.
(b) Stratification.
(c) Status.
(d) Role.
Ans: (c) Status.
